Various attempts have been made to characterize and beneficiate bauxite ores across the globe. Studies conducted at Hindalco with typical bauxite ore from Central Indian deposits have revelated that such ores are amenable to simple beneficiation process to reduce the reactive silica content to some extent.

→ WhatsApp: +86 18221755073This refining process generates bauxite residue as a by-product. To produce 1 kg of aluminium, it requires 2 kg of alumina, which consumes 6 kg of bauxite, leaving behind 4 kg of bauxite residue.
